The GUHRING 9005350025000 is a taper length twist drill bit designed for precision drilling in metalworking applications. Built from high speed steel (HSS) with a bright/uncoated finish, this bit features a parabolic flute geometry and a 130-degree point angle. The overall length measures 3.734 inches with a flute length of 2.4375 inches, giving it extended reach compared to jobber-length bits. The cylindrical shank matches the 0.0984 inch (2.50 mm) cutting diameter. Web-thinned construction reduces entry force and improves chip evacuation. Manufactured to DIN 340 specification, this bit is suited for production environments where consistent hole quality matters.
This drill bit is intended for use in aluminum alloy, cast iron, and steel. The parabolic flute profile handles chip clearance efficiently in these materials, making it a practical choice for CNC machining centers, drill presses, and hand-held power tools. At a 10xD flute-to-diameter ratio, the bit handles moderate-depth holes without excessive deflection. The Series 535 designation identifies it within the Guhring standard drill line, which is stocked by tool cribs and machine shops that require reliable, repeatable small-diameter drilling.
Designed as a DIN 340 taper length replacement for applications requiring a 2.50 mm (0.0984 inch) HSS drill bit in aluminum alloy, cast iron, and steel. Compatible with any standard cylindrical-shank drill chuck accepting the 0.0984 inch shank diameter.
Installation and use of this drill bit should be performed by machinists or qualified trade personnel familiar with rotary cutting tools. Secure the cylindrical shank fully in a properly rated drill chuck or collet before operation. Inspect the cutting edges for wear or damage before each use — a chipped small-diameter bit can deflect or break without warning. Follow applicable shop safety protocols and machine manufacturer guidelines for speeds and feeds appropriate to the workpiece material.
